Weoley Hill Bowling Club
(Crown Green Bowls)

 
Weoley Hill Bowling Club was established in 1928 and 81 years on it has a thriving mixed membership. Enthusiastic crown green bowlers of all ages play regular friendly and competitive matches against other local clubs as well as enjoying social bowling with each other. There is an active programme of weekly social bowling between members, and other events, often as part of an organized fundraising or charity event.
 

Even during the close season (October to March) we have a regular series of social activities for members and friends to share.
